Ingredients

Rainbow Orzo Salad features fresh ingredients that create a delightful combination of textures and flavors.

Dressing Ingredients

  • 1/4 cup extra virgin olive oil
  • 2 tablespoons red wine vinegar
  • 1 tablespoon lemon juice
  • 1 teaspoon honey
  • 1 clove garlic, minced
  • 1/2 teaspoon Italian seasoning
  • salt and pepper, to taste

Salad Ingredients

  • 1 1/2 cups uncooked orzo pasta
  • 1 cup cherry tomatoes, quartered
  • 1/2 orange bell pepper, diced
  • 1/2 yellow bell pepper, diced
  • 1 cup diced cucumber
  • 1/4 cup chopped red onion (optional)
  • 1/4 cup crumbled feta cheese
  • 1/4 cup fresh basil, sliced
  • salt and pepper, to taste

How to Make Rainbow Orzo Salad

Step 1: Cook the Orzo

  • Bring a large pot of salted water to a boil.
  • Add the uncooked orzo pasta and cook until al dente according to package directions.

Step 2: Prepare the Dressing

  • While the pasta cooks, combine all dressing ingredients in a small bowl.
  • Whisk until smooth or shake them together in a jar until thoroughly mixed. Set aside.

Step 3: Rinse the Pasta

  • Once cooked, drain the orzo using a colander and rinse under cold water for about one minute until cooled.
  • Transfer the rinsed orzo into a large mixing bowl.

Step 4: Combine Ingredients

  • Add the cherry tomatoes, diced peppers, cucumber, optional red onion, feta cheese, and sliced basil to the bowl with orzo.
  • Toss gently to combine all ingredients evenly.

Step 5: Dress and Serve

  • Drizzle the prepared dressing over the salad mixture.
  • Toss again to ensure everything is coated well. Season with salt and pepper to taste.
  • Serve immediately or store in an airtight container in the refrigerator for later enjoyment.

Common Mistakes to Avoid

When making Rainbow Orzo Salad, it’s easy to overlook a few key details. Here are some common mistakes to avoid for the best results.

  • Skipping the rinse: Failing to rinse the orzo after cooking can make it sticky. Always rinse with cold water to cool it down and separate the pasta.
  • Overdressing the salad: Adding too much dressing can overwhelm the flavors. Start with a smaller amount and add more as needed.
  • Neglecting seasoning: Not seasoning the vegetables can lead to blandness. Taste and adjust salt and pepper before serving for maximum flavor.
  • Using stale ingredients: Old vegetables or expired cheese can ruin your dish. Always use fresh produce and quality cheese for the best taste.
  • Ignoring customization: Sticking strictly to the recipe can limit creativity. Feel free to add other veggies or proteins that you enjoy.

Storage & Reheating Instructions

Refrigerator Storage

  • Store in an airtight container for up to 3 days.
  • Keep it in the main compartment, not in the door, for optimal freshness.

Freezing Rainbow Orzo Salad

  • Freeze for up to 1 month if you want to preserve it longer.
  • Use a freezer-safe container, leaving some space at the top for expansion.
